Abstract

The Independent Curriculum was developed in response to the challenges of learning during the COVID-19 pandemic and to create an education system more adaptable to current developments. Its implementation requires effective curriculum management, particularly in early childhood education (PAUD), which has unique learning characteristics. This study aims to analyze the management of the Independent Curriculum in PAUD, including its benefits, challenges, and efforts to optimize its implementation. The study used a qualitative approach with a library research method. Data were collected from various scientific sources, including journals, books, and relevant online references, and analyzed deductively and interpretively. The study results indicate that the Independent Curriculum provides flexibility in the learning process, supports the optimal development of students' potential, and enhances teachers' creativity and innovation in designing learning activities. However, its implementation still faces several obstacles, including limited facilities and infrastructure, gaps in access to technology, and teacher competency in implementing differentiated learning. Therefore, planned, systematic, and sustainable curriculum management is a key factor in overcoming these challenges. With effective management, the Independent Curriculum plays a strategic role in improving the quality of learning in PAUD through a flexible, contextual, and student-centered approach.
